At the CAS we offer ten exceptional graduate
degree programs that are spread out among four divisions. In our Division of Chemistry and Biological
Sciences, we have a M.S. in Analytical Chemistry and a M.S. in Environmental
Biology. In the Division of
Communication Visual and Performing Arts, our graduate programs include a M.A.
in Art, a M.A. in Communication and Training, and an Independent Film and
Digital Imaging, Master of Fine Arts.
Our Division of Computing Mathematics
and Technology has two master programs, a M.S. in Computer Science and M.S. in
Mathematics. The CAS’s Division of
Humanities and Social Services offer students a Master of Arts in Criminal
Justice, Master of Arts in English and a Master of Arts in Political and
Justice Studies.
